Update on Bryan's 5+1 for a 500. My 540 has my personal design 6 stack and Bryan knows how I do it but I had just put 200 yds of momoi 60 on my reel and today I hooked something while mango fishing and it was probably a big shark. I keep my drag so tight that I can't pull any off with one wrap around my hand because I horse them from the reef. This drag has tested at 45 Lb. This thing took off at high speed with close to 40 lb of drag and stripped down to about 50 yds and I cut it before risking breaking my spool. This thing never slowed down a bit so I knew I would never land it.
Respooled the reel with the boat line and wrapped the line around my hand and I could not pull any so the drag integrity was still there. My next fish was one of the big 30 lb red snappers and I horsed it right off the reef.
This was a great drag test. Bryan's design works great.
